The Works of George Swinnock V3 (1868) is a collection of writings by the English Puritan preacher and author, George Swinnock. This volume contains a variety of Swinnock's sermons and treatises on religious topics such as the nature of God, sin, salvation, and the Christian life. The book is divided into sections, each covering a different theme, and includes a detailed table of contents for easy reference. Swinnock's writing style is clear, concise, and deeply spiritual, offering readers a window into the mind of a devout Christian thinker from the seventeenth century. This edition of The Works of George Swinnock V3 was originally published in 1868 and has been carefully edited and formatted for modern readers.
